Win10中使用MinGW编译Qt5.5.1
2015-12-06 20:01
627 查看
计算机系统:Win10(64bit)
Qt版本:5.5.1
编译器:MinGW4.9.2
1 安装MinGW
1.1 在线安装
可以使用mingw-w64-install.exe进行安装,参数选择如下图所示:
1.2 设置环境变量
新建一个环境变量MINGW_4_9_2,如下图所示:
然后将上述变量添加到PATH变量中,如下图所示:
2 配置和编译
2.1 源码下载
到这里下载Qt源码。
2.2 查看配置说明
解压Qt源码,并通过doc命令终端进入到其根目录,然后使用configure -help命令查看配置说明,如下图所示:
2.3 配置
输入下面的命令进行配置:
上述各参数的含义可以通过2.2小节的方法查看。需要注意的是,如果没有指定-opengl desktop,在配置过程中将会提示:
在配置过程中,开始时候只需输入y对license进行确认(如下图):
然后就无需人为干预配置的过程。
2.4 编译
上述的配置生成了相应的Makefile文件,这里只需要 执行mingw32-make命令即可启动编译。
3 安装
执行下面命令,即可将Qt安装到2.3小节中指定的“D:\Qt\Qt5.5.1_MinGW4.9.2_x64”目录中。
注:在执行上述安装命令之前,需要先手工创建D:\Qt\Qt5.5.1_MinGW4.9.2_x64目录。
参考资料
[1]在Windows环境下使用MinGW编译Qt 4.8.6
Qt版本:5.5.1
编译器:MinGW4.9.2
1 安装MinGW
1.1 在线安装
可以使用mingw-w64-install.exe进行安装,参数选择如下图所示:
1.2 设置环境变量
新建一个环境变量MINGW_4_9_2,如下图所示:
然后将上述变量添加到PATH变量中,如下图所示:
2 配置和编译
2.1 源码下载
到这里下载Qt源码。
2.2 查看配置说明
解压Qt源码,并通过doc命令终端进入到其根目录,然后使用configure -help命令查看配置说明,如下图所示:
2.3 配置
输入下面的命令进行配置:
configure -debug-and-release -opensource -prefix "D:\Qt\Qt5.5.1_MinGW4.9.2_x64" -platform win32-g++ -nomake examples -opengl desktop
上述各参数的含义可以通过2.2小节的方法查看。需要注意的是,如果没有指定-opengl desktop,在配置过程中将会提示:
在配置过程中,开始时候只需输入y对license进行确认(如下图):
然后就无需人为干预配置的过程。
2.4 编译
上述的配置生成了相应的Makefile文件,这里只需要 执行mingw32-make命令即可启动编译。
mingw32-make
3 安装
执行下面命令,即可将Qt安装到2.3小节中指定的“D:\Qt\Qt5.5.1_MinGW4.9.2_x64”目录中。
mingw32-make install
注:在执行上述安装命令之前,需要先手工创建D:\Qt\Qt5.5.1_MinGW4.9.2_x64目录。
参考资料
[1]在Windows环境下使用MinGW编译Qt 4.8.6
相关文章推荐
- Qt Assistant介绍
- Qt Assistant介绍
- Qt 用QSqlDatabase 连接Firebird数据库
- qt creator工程转为vs工程
- qt 如何调用c函数
- qt5 解析Json文件
- MySQL的安装、编译Qt驱动和测试
- MySQL的安装、编译Qt驱动和测试
- PyQt5教程(五)——对话框
- Qt 设置鼠标
- Qt 打开保存文件对话框
- Qt 设置程序图标
- Qt 创建上下文菜单
- Qt如何实现多窗口调用
- Opencv--Qt5编译与配置
- Windows下 Qt5.1 not load The QtplatForm plugin "windows"
- QT5 下udp 编程实例
- QT线程(一):线程类 http://blog.csdn.net/calm_agan/article/details/6300709
- QtPropertyBrowser简介
- Qt udp